The cost of a digital copy for libraries is also many multiples of the cost of a paper copy, which libraries purchase at normal retail prices. I talked with a local high school librarian who told me his library simply couldn't justify having ebooks as they could cost as much as $200 for licensing that still isn't perpetual.
